History of Olives in Cocktails

Olives, particularly green olives, have been associated with certain types of cocktails for decades. The most iconic example is the Martini, a classic cocktail made with gin and dry vermouth, garnished with an olive. The origin of the olive garnish in Martinis is not well-documented, but it is believed to have started in the United States in the late 19th or early 20th century. The idea of using olives could have been influenced by the Italian tradition of serving martinis with olives as a snack. Over time, the olive has become an integral part of the Martini’s identity, symbolizing sophistication and elegance.

The Role of Olives Beyond Martinis

While olives are most famously associated with Martinis, they are not exclusive to this cocktail. Other drinks, such as the Dirty Martini (which includes olive brine for added flavor) and the Gibson (a Martini variant garnished with a pickled onion but sometimes made with olives), also feature olives or their by-products. Olives serve not only as a garnish but also as a flavor component, with their salty, slightly bitter taste complementing the spirits and other ingredients in the cocktail. The versatility of olives allows mixologists to experiment with different types of olives and methods of preparation, such as stuffing or marinating them, to enhance the cocktail experience.

Types of Olives Used in Cocktails

Not all olives are created equal when it comes to their suitability for cocktails. Green olives are the most commonly used, particularly the pitted variety, as they provide a clean, crisp flavor. However, other types of olives, such as Kalamata or stuffed olives, can also be used, depending on the desired flavor profile. The quality and origin of the olives can significantly impact the taste and overall experience of the cocktail, making the selection of olives an important consideration for bartenders and cocktail enthusiasts.

What types of olives are typically used in cocktails?

The type of olives used in cocktails can vary depending on the specific drink and the desired flavor profile. Green olives are the most commonly used, as they have a milder flavor and a firmer texture that holds up well to being pierced with a cocktail pick. Some popular varieties of green olives used in cocktails include Cerignola, Castelvetrano, and Picholine. These olives are often pitted and stuffed with ingredients such as pimentos, almonds, or blue cheese, which add an extra layer of flavor to the cocktail.

In addition to green olives, some bartenders also use black olives or other types of olives, such as Kalamata or Gaeta, to create a distinctive flavor profile. For example, a Dirty Martini might use a combination of green and black olives to create a salty, umami flavor. Ultimately, the type of olive used in a cocktail is a matter of personal preference, and bartenders often experiment with different varieties to create unique and innovative flavor combinations.

Can I use olives in any type of cocktail?

While olives are a versatile ingredient, they may not be suitable for every type of cocktail. In general, olives pair well with clear spirits such as gin and vodka, as well as with dry, savory flavors such as vermouth and citrus. They can also be used in combination with other ingredients, such as onions or pickles, to create a unique flavor profile. However, olives may not be the best choice for cocktails that feature sweet or fruity flavors, as they can clash with the other ingredients and create an unbalanced taste experience.

When using olives in cocktails, it’s also important to consider the flavor profile of the olive itself. For example, a strong, briny olive may overpower the other ingredients in a delicate cocktail, while a milder olive may get lost in a bold, savory drink. By choosing the right type of olive and using it in combination with complementary ingredients, bartenders can create unique and delicious flavor combinations that elevate the cocktail experience.
